In average, 88% of full-time first-time beginning undergraduate students (freshmen) have received grants and/or scholarships at Most Searched Online Programs In Wisconsin. The average financial aid amount received is $24,046. For all undergraduate students, 73.22% received grants/scholarship and the average aid amount is $18,219

The average tuition & fees for the schools is $8,235 for state residents and $31,680 for out-of-state students. The average cost of attendance (COA) including tuition & fees, book & supplies, and living costs for Most Searched Online Programs In Wisconsin is $48,762 and, after receiving financial aid, the actual cost is down to $24,716.
